scrutch Posted April 23, 2010 Posted April 23, 2010 What's the difference between the Minn Kota Powerdrive V2 and the Terrova models? They both seem to have the same description. I know they're the only two Minn Kota models that are compatable with i-Pilot. Am I missing something? Quote
Super User slonezp Posted April 24, 2010 Super User Posted April 24, 2010 The terrova has higher thrust options. The foot control will not work in conjunction with ipilot and powerdrive v2(hand control only), but does work with terrova. Terrova is about $300 more. Quote
jettech Posted April 26, 2010 Posted April 26, 2010 I just went through this two weeks ago when a stump killed my old T/M. The main difference between the Terrova and the Powerdrive V2 is the mount. The mount is much beefier on the Terrova. The T/M units are essentially the same. The foot controls are a little different, Personally I like the looks of the terrova foot control better. As I have a small 17' F/S. I went with the Powerdrive V2 and saved myself about 250.00. Your needs may differ from mine though.
